This advisory discloses a vulnerability within the FTP client in AceFTP. When exploited, this vulnerability allows an anonymous attacker to write files to arbitrary locations on a Windows user's system.
The FTP client does not properly sanitise filenames containing directory traversal sequences (forward-slash) that are received from an FTP server in response to the LIST command.
An example of such a response from a malicious FTP server is shown below.
Response to LIST (forward-slash):
-rw-r--r-- 1 ftp ftp 20 Mar 01 05:37 /../../../../../../../../../testfile.txt\r\n
By tricking a user to download a directory from a malicious FTP server that contains files with fowward-slash directory traversal sequences in their filenames, it is possible for the attacker to write files to arbitrary locations on a user's system with privileges of that user. An attacker can potentially leverage this issue to write files into a user's Windows Startup folder and execute arbitrary code when the user logs on.
While the arcade (MVS) versions load instantly, the Neo Geo CD versions are preferred by many for two reasons:
I can provide custom setup steps and performance tweaks based on your hardware. Share public link
Before you download anything, here is what you :
Use the CHD format if possible. It compresses the game audio and data into a single file, saving storage space and preventing file clutter. Optimizing Performance and Controls
While each emulator has its process, setting up is the most common and effective method. Here's how to get it right on your Android device. neo geo cd emulator android
: In RetroArch's NeoCD core options, enable "Skip Loading" to bypass the original console's notorious loading screens.
With the right emulator setup, your Android device transforms into a powerhouse capable of delivering the peak of 90s arcade luxury, complete with the definitive arranged soundtracks that made the Neo Geo CD a collector's dream. If you want to fine-tune your configuration, let me know: What or processor you are using Whether you prefer touch controls or a physical gamepad Which particular games you are trying to run
Use an Android file manager to move your neocd_bios.bin file into the RetroArch/system/ folder on your device.
. Unlike cartridge-based Neo Geo AES/MVS systems, CD emulation requires specific BIOS files and folder structures to handle disc-based media. Best Neo Geo CD Emulators for Android RetroArch (NeoCD Core) While the arcade (MVS) versions load instantly, the
Increase the speed multiplier (e.g., 2x, 4x, or Native Hack) to reduce or completely eliminate loading times. Controller Recommendations
Neo Geo CD emulation on Android is a fantastic way to explore one of the most revered libraries in gaming history. It requires a bit more initial effort than simply downloading a free game from the app store, but the reward is access to some of the most beautiful and challenging 2D games ever created.
Requires a modern, mid-to-high-end Android device for flawless performance. Required Files for Setup
While most Neo Geo CD games emulate well, some dedicated enthusiasts have noted that certain titles may have issues. For example, using RetroArch, one user found that "Street Hoop has sound fx issues and you need to revert to an older neocd core" . The emulation landscape is always changing, so using the most up-to-date cores or reading dedicated game-specific forums is always wise. Optimizing Performance and Controls While each emulator has
The user interface has a steep learning curve for beginners. 2. NEO.emu
Controller support remains central to the Neo Geo feel. Fighting games like King of Fighters and Samurai Shodown demand precise inputs and timing. Bluetooth controllers, USB gamepads via OTG, and even virtual on-screen pads each change the experience. On-screen controls are convenient but rob players of tactile feedback, while physical controllers restore muscle memory and competitive viability. Emulators that include robust mapping and support for popular controllers (Xbox, PlayStation, 8BitDo) offer the clearest path to authentic play.
A standard format where the .cue file acts as a track sheet for the .bin data tracks. Always load the .cue file in your emulator.
Avoid downloading files/directories from untrusted FTP servers.
2008-06-15 - Vulnerability Discovered.
2008-06-16 - Vulnerability Details Sent to Vendor via online support form (no reply).
2008-06-18 - Vulnerability Details Sent to Vendor again via online support form (no reply).
2008-06-25 - Vulnerability Details Sent to Vendor again via online support form (no reply).
2008-06-27 - Public Release.